Abstract

The utility model discloses a medical stretcher device for emergency department, which comprises a stretcher plate, wherein both sides of the stretcher plate are provided with a lifting device, support columns are arranged around the bottom of the stretcher plate, the lifting device comprises a support plate, a lifting rod and a buffer device, the two sides of the stretcher plate are both fixedly provided with the support plate, the lifting rod is arranged between the two support plates, both ends of the lifting rod are connected with the support plates through the buffer device, the buffer device comprises a movable block, the end part of the lifting rod is fixedly provided with a movable block, the support plate is provided with a movable groove matched with the movable block, a buffer column is arranged in the movable groove and runs through the movable block, both sides of the movable block are provided with first springs, and the two first springs are sleeved on the buffer column, reduce the vibration to the patient when moving, prevent the secondary injury.

Referring to fig. 1-4, the present invention provides a technical solution: the utility model provides a medical stretcher device for emergency department, including stretcher plate 1, stretcher plate 1's both sides all are equipped with lifts up the device, stretcher plate 1's bottom all is equipped with support column 7 all around, it includes backup pad 2 to lift up the device, lifting rod 3 and buffer 4, stretcher plate 1's both sides are all fixed and are equipped with backup pad 2, be equipped with lifting rod 3 between two backup pads 2, and be connected through buffer 4 between lifting rod 3 both ends and the backup pad 2, buffer 4 includes movable block 41, movable groove 42, buffering post 43 and first spring 44, lifting rod 3's end fixing is equipped with movable block 41, be equipped with in the backup pad 2 with movable block 41 complex movable groove 42, be equipped with buffering post 43 in the movable groove 42, buffering post 43 runs through movable block 41, the both sides of movable block all are equipped with first spring 44, and two first spring 44 all overlap and establish on buffering post 43.
Furthermore, universal wheels 8 are arranged at the bottoms of the support columns 7, and the universal wheels 8 are matched with the support columns 7, so that the stretcher can be moved in an auxiliary manner, a patient can be conveniently moved, and the labor amount of personnel lifting the stretcher is reduced;
furthermore, a protective sleeve 5 is sleeved on the lifting rod 3, the protective sleeve 5 is made of rubber pads, and the friction force between a stretcher lifting person and the lifting rod 3 can be increased and the lifting rod 3 is more comfortable to hold by the aid of the protective sleeve 5 made of rubber;
furthermore, the bottom of the stretcher plate 1 is rotatably provided with a damping sleeve 6, a supporting column 7 is inserted into the damping sleeve 6, the end part of the supporting column 7 is fixedly provided with a limiting block 9, a second spring 10 is arranged in the damping sleeve 6, the second spring 10 is arranged at the upper end of the limiting block 9, when the universal wheel 8 is matched with the supporting column 7 to move, the universal wheel 8 generates vibration to extrude the second spring 10 in the damping sleeve 6 on an uneven road surface, so that the stretcher can be damped, the vibration generated to a patient is reduced, and the secondary injury of the patient is prevented;
further, two clamping plates 11 are fixedly arranged at the bottom of the stretcher plate 1, the two clamping plates 11 are rotatably connected with the shock-absorbing sleeve 6 through a rotating shaft 12, a spring buckle 13 is arranged in the shock-absorbing sleeve 6, two limiting holes 14 matched with the spring buckle 13 are arranged at one side of each clamping plate 11, a groove 15 matched with the spring buckle 13 is arranged in the shock-absorbing sleeve 6, limiting clamping blocks 16 are arranged at two sides of the spring buckle 13, a third spring 17 is arranged in the groove 15, the third spring 17 is arranged between the spring buckle 13 and the groove 15, when the universal wheel 8 needs to be used for moving, the spring buckle 13 extrudes the third spring 17 to enter the groove 15 by pressing the spring buckle 13, then the shock-absorbing sleeve 6 is rotated to be vertical to the stretcher plate 1, then the spring buckle 13 is ejected from the limiting holes 14 to be limited under the action of the third spring 17, otherwise, the shock-absorbing sleeve 6 can be parallel to the stretcher plate 1, the support column 7 and the universal wheel 8 are retracted.
The working principle is as follows: when a patient needs to be moved, under the condition of poor ground road conditions, the stretcher plate 1 is lifted by lifting the lifting rods 3 at the two ends of the stretcher plate 1, then the stretcher plate can be moved, a stretcher lifting person can generate vibration in the moving process, the two symmetrical first springs 44 absorb the vibration of the lifting rods 3 through the movable blocks 41, when the stretcher is moved on a flat road surface, the spring buckles 13 are pressed to extrude the third springs 17 into the grooves 15 by pressing the spring buckles 13, then the shock absorption sleeves 6 are rotated, then the spring buckles 13 are popped out from the limiting holes 14 under the action of the third springs 17 to limit, the shock absorption sleeves 6 can drive the supporting columns 7 and the universal wheels 8 to be vertical to the stretcher plate 1, so that the stretcher can be moved in an auxiliary manner by matching the universal wheels 8 with the supporting columns 7, the movement of the patient is facilitated, the labor amount of the stretcher lifting person is reduced, and when the stretcher is moved, the universal wheel 8 produces vibrations and can extrude second spring 10 in the shock attenuation cover 6 to can carry out the shock attenuation to the stretcher, reduce and produce vibrations to the patient, prevent patient secondary damage.
